Job Description

University of Iowa Health Care Department of Nursing is seeking a 50 Medical Assistant IIto work in the Adult Psychiatry Clinic.
Responsibilities include but not limited to:
  • Medical Assistants in the Medicine Specialty Clinics are able to work with a variety of internal medicine patients. Dependent on the area some of the skills learned can include allergy/skin testing walking desaturations spirometry 24 hour blood pressure monitoring and IM/SQ injections. This is a great place to learn and grow as a Medical Assistant because it gives you the ability to expand your skill set in several areas.
  • Medical Assistantsspend a great deal of time working with our patients doing faxes and limited phone triage.
  • Team structure is unique and Medical Assistants will be working with RNs LPNs Paramedics andNursing Assistants. This structure gives Medical Assistantsthe chance to work on their delegation and prioritization skills.
  • There is room for advancement to a Medical Assistant lead.
  • Performs technical patient care and related clerical functions in an ambulatory setting.
  • Duties may involve the use of electronic word/data processing equipment and/or conventional office equipment.

Percent of Time: 50
Schedule: Monday Friday. Between the hours of 0730 and 1700. No weekends holidays or call.
Hourly: $19.21 to commensurate.
Location:UI Health Care Main Campus (PFP)
Benefits Highlights:Fringe benefit package including paid vacation; sick leave; health dental life and disability insurance options; and generous employer contributions into retirement plans.Complete informationregardingthe full benefits package may be viewed at: Eligibility Requirements:
